| Obverse description | Crowned effigy of Queen Victoria facing left, her hair gathered in a chignon and bound with a ribbon, wearing a jewelled coronet, engraved by Leonard Charles Wyon whose signature L C WYON appears in small letters below the truncation. The portrait is contained within an inner beaded circle, with the date displayed prominently in large numerals below the bust along the inner border. The legend VICTORIA QUEEN arcs around the upper periphery between the inner beaded circle and the outer toothed border, with small ornamental rosettes serving as stops at the sides. |
